Scott Fischer’s (Jake Gyllenhaal) mountaineering costume from the Working Title adventure biopic Everest (2015). The movie tells the story of New Zealand's Robert "Rob" Edwin Hall, who on May 10, 1996, together with Scott Fischer, teamed up on a joint expedition to ascend Mount Everest.
Jake Gyllenhaal plays Scott Fischer, one of two experienced mountain guides leading groups up Mount Everest the day of the 1996 disaster.
Gyllenhaal wore this costume during the climb up the higher levels of Mount Everest towards its summit.
The lot consists of a teal and black Helly Hansen down suit, a black woollen “Mountain Madness” hat, a pair of blue and green Helly Hansen gloves, a grey fleece neck buff, black Uvex goggles with orange lens, a pair of black Forty Below overboots (size large), a black thermal Helly Hansen beanie, a turquoise length of webbing and a set of black crampons. An original wardrobe tag is attached to the webbing reading “Webbing for Scott Fischer.” Labels are adhered to the inside of the down suit, gloves, hat, neck buff, goggles, overboots and crampons reading “Scott Fischer.” Showing signs of production wear including imitation snow residue throughout and the down suit’s padding has been removed, the costume remains in good condition.
